Multi-mass dynamic model of a variable-length tether used in a high altitude wind energy system

Abstract
•A multi-mass dynamics model of a variable length tether has been developed.•The modelling approach enables straightforward description of the aerodynamic drag.•The model is used in high altitude wind energy system control-oriented simulations.•The model accurately describes the shape, forces and vibrations of the tether.
